Instead use a translation gateway. Note: In the protocol translation gateway pattern, only the IoT Edge gateway has an identity with IoT Hub. The translation module receives messages from downstream devices, translates them into a supported protocol, and then the IoT Edge device sends the messages on behalf of the downstream devices. All information looks like it is coming from one device, the gateway. https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/iot-edge/iot-edge-as-gateway
